VCS Coverage 手册笔记

##########################################################
# 《Coverage Technology User Guide》.pdf
##########################################################
#############################
【Line Coverage】
A zero execution count pin-points a line of code that has not been exercised that could be the
source of a 【potential design error】

【-cm_line contassign】

【Toggle Coverage】
   how much testing is actually being performed at the 【gate level】

【Condition Coverage】
 Enabling Condition Coverage in 【For Loops】 
 Enabling Condition Coverage in 【Tasks and Functions】

【-cm_noconst】
The goal of performing c onstant analysis is to remove 【unreachable】 
coverage targets from the computat ion of the score and the reports, 
so that you can focus on the 【hittable】 targets that need testing. 


#############################
【URG】 for batch merging, grading, and reporting, 
【DVE】 Coverage GUI for interactive analysis

URG indicates this information in the modinfo.txt/
mod*.html pages as to 【which test covered each metric】
URG 【-show tests】【-show maxtests】  

【–diff】 
urg –dir mydir1.vdb mydir2.vdb –tests myfile –diff

Reporting Only 【Uncovered】 Objects: urg 【–show brief】

【–show summary】


#############################
【Post-processing】

【Merging】

【Grading and Coverage Analysis】

【Exclusion】 –elfile filename.el

Autograde to eliminate 【redundant tests】
Map the subhierarchy coverage 【from one design to another】


##########################################################
# 《Coverage Technology Reference Manual》.pdf
##########################################################

【-cm_tgl mda】

【-cm_tgl portsonly】

【-cm_cond full/allops】

【-cm_constfile】

【-cm_fsmcfg】

【-cm_fsmopt sequence 】

【-cm_count】

【-cm_start/-cm_stop N】

【coverage -tgl off/on】

【-cm_glitch  period】

  • 0
    点赞
  • 3
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值